Testing plays an important role in development of new products and ongoing management of existing product lines. There’s a saying in the industry that behind every great software developer is an equally great tester. This is because once a product reaches a certain point in its development the developers must hand it over to the tester to see if it works (or doesn’t work) as it’s meant to. It will be your job to work as hard as you can to ‘break’ the new product or feature to help in the development process. You’ll work closely with programmers, user interface specialists, and program managers to understand more about what each product is meant to do, its key features and who will use it. Then you’ll run functional, use case, and customer scenario tests. Eventually, you will help design or write your own tests. The ultimate goal is to resolve any bugs and improve the quality of the finished product.Skills and Interests
